Summary/Abstract: The teaching approach for verb forms in French as a Foreign Language (FLE) must be clear, interactive, and adapted to the learners' level, combining structured explanations, contextualized examples, and progressive activation. Conjugation teaching becomes more effective when it moves beyond the rigid framework of verb lists and is grounded in real-life communicative situations. Verb forms occupy a central position in foreign language acquisition. The learner must first learn to perceive the characteristics of the verb forms in the second language that differ from those of their native language. Only then will they be able to use them correctly in their own writing. Acquiring the French verb system requires considerable time and effort from the learner. Grammatical tenses are embedded in the verb form itself through specific markers. Verb tenses provide information about the verb's temporal value (the placement of the action within a specific time period), aspect, and modal values (the speaker's position in relation to their statement). For learners of French as a foreign language, it is not enough to define the usage values of verb tenses; it is essential to ensure their correct use by describing the situations in which this usage will be relevant. From one language to another, the inventory of verb forms is not the same, and verbal markers do not denote the same semantic values.
